Description

Task of KI grinding complexes is fine and ultra-fine dry grinding, as well as disintegration of ore and non-ore materials of different density, solidity, and abrasive capacity.

Offered grinding stations make it possible to produce up to 15 t/h of several narrow fractions of the finished product within the required fineness range (-0.02 … -0.5 mm).

KI grinding complexes are successfully used in cement and micropowder production, etc. More than 50% of the total micro calcite amount is produced by KI grinding complexes manufactured by Ural-Omega Company.

KI grinding complex operation is based on the centrifugal impact dry grinding principle and dynamic classification of the raw product particles. Specific power consumption reduction and absence of overground classes is provided due to the iterative (uninterrupted) operation cycle of the KI complex: “grinding – separation – continuous discharge of the finished product from the grinding process”.
